Ohio State University-Lima Campus ranked #-1 and Northwest Indian ranked #-1 in national university ranking. The following statements compare Ohio State University-Lima Campus and Northwest Indian College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are public.
- Ohio State University-Lima Campus's tuition ($34,718) is more expensive than Northwest Indian ($3,969).
- Northwest Indian's students to faculty ratio (11 to 1) is lower than Ohio State University-Lima Campus (16 to 1).
- Ohio State University-Lima Campus (740 students) is larger than Northwest Indian (696 students) with more enrolled students.
- Northwest Indian ($8,479) has higher amount of financial aid than Ohio State University-Lima Campus ($6,274).
- Northwest Indian's graduation rate (27%) is higher than Ohio State University-Lima Campus (18%).
